The Bently Nevada 330101-00-60-05-01-00 is a precision vibration monitoring sensor designed to ensure optimal performance and early detection of potential failures in rotating machinery. Part of the Bently Nevada 3300 Series, this sensor provides continuous condition monitoring, helping operators identify and mitigate issues before they lead to significant downtime or damage.
This vibration sensor is engineered with advanced technology to monitor machinery health by capturing vibrations in critical components such as motors, turbines, pumps, and compressors. It offers a reliable solution for industries where unplanned outages and failures can result in costly repairs and downtime. The 330101-00-60-05-01-00 integrates seamlessly into existing machinery health monitoring systems and can help facilitate predictive maintenance practices to extend the life of critical equipment.

The Bently Nevada 330101-00-60-05-01-00 sensor is utilized across various industrial sectors where continuous condition monitoring of rotating machinery is essential. Its applications include:
Power Generation: Used to monitor turbines, motors, and generators to prevent unplanned outages and ensure efficient operation.
Oil & Gas: Helps in monitoring critical machinery such as pumps, compressors, and motors in offshore and onshore oil extraction and refining plants.
Manufacturing: Applied to machines, conveyor systems, and motors in factories and assembly lines to ensure reliable performance.
Water & Wastewater Treatment: Ensures pumps and other essential equipment are operating at peak efficiency, preventing failure and reducing maintenance costs.
